Every transcoded bundle produced by the Renderhive farm must be signed before it reaches the distribution cache. Worker nodes hash the output segment manifest, and the signer service attaches a detached signature that downstream players verify at fetch time. Unsigned artifacts are quarantined automatically after the nightly sweep, so don't skip this step when testing locally. New team members should import the current farm signing key into their toolchain before their first deploy. The active signing key is:

release key, kahif-yagap: bky3_1JN

Prepared for the incoming director of Thornapple Logistics. Q2 operating cash flow is forecast at a modest surplus, assuming the Grayfen contract renews on schedule. Receivables ageing has improved since the collections push, though the Westmoor depot lease renewal creates a concentration of outflows in month two. Capital spending is deferred except for fleet maintenance. A downside scenario, reflecting a delayed Grayfen renewal, is attached. The planning assumptions behind these figures are summarised below.

confidential, kagup-bafog: Fraaxax Group is in early talks to buy Soroxox Group for about $343.8 million. The Olidor launch date is June 14, and nothing goes to the press before then. Legal wants the Aldmirek Logistics term sheet signed before July 23.

## Break-Glass: Charset Sniffer Service

If the encoding detection worker for uploaded text files wedges (usually a BOM-less UTF-16 edge case), maintainers can bypass Quillgate and restart the sniffer directly. Use the emergency console on the Tarnwick bastion. Access requires the break-glass recovery passphrase, rotated quarterly by the platform team. It appears below.

vault phrase of tajep-kagef = istwyn-wendor-jorius

## Environment Variables — Receipt Mailer

The Tithely-Oak donation-receipt mailer reads its config from mailer.env. Set MAILER_FROM_NAME, RECEIPT_TEMPLATE_ID, and BATCH_SIZE (default 200). Receipts send within five minutes of a confirmed donation; retries are automatic. Don't touch the template ID without design sign-off. For the mailer to authenticate with the outbound relay, add this line:

env line for fafof-fahag: LEDGER_TOKEN5=f8790